3D Printing in Oral Surgery
To improve the field of dental surgery, you can check out the subtopic of 3D printing in oral surgery. This ingenious innovation has the possible to change the means oral doctors run and deal with clients. Below are 4 essential methods which 3D printing is forming the area:
- ** Customized Surgical Guides **: 3D printing allows for the production of extremely accurate and patient-specific medical overviews, enhancing the accuracy and performance of procedures.
- ** Implant Prosthetics **: With 3D printing, oral surgeons can produce personalized implant prosthetics that flawlessly fit a client's one-of-a-kind anatomy, leading to better end results and client contentment.
- ** Bone Grafting **: 3D printing enables the production of patient-specific bone grafts, minimizing the demand for typical implanting methods and enhancing recovery and recovery time.
- ** Education and learning and Training **: 3D printing can be made use of to create practical medical models for instructional objectives, enabling oral surgeons to exercise complex treatments before doing them on patients.

Minimally Invasive Strategies
To even more advance the field of dental surgery, welcome the capacity of minimally invasive methods that can significantly benefit both doctors and clients alike.
Minimally intrusive methods are transforming the field by minimizing surgical trauma, reducing post-operative pain, and speeding up the healing process. These strategies involve utilizing smaller lacerations and specialized instruments to perform procedures with accuracy and effectiveness.
By making use of sophisticated imaging modern technology, such as cone beam calculated tomography (CBCT), doctors can precisely plan and implement surgical procedures with marginal invasiveness.
In addition, making use of lasers in dental surgery enables specific tissue cutting and coagulation, causing minimized blood loss and minimized recovery time.
With minimally invasive methods, clients can experience quicker healing, decreased scarring, and boosted results, making it an important aspect of the future of oral surgery.
